Kimberly Dickey is a scholar working on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Biomedical Engineering and Infectious Diseases. According to data from OpenAlex, Kimberly Dickey has authored 4 papers receiving a total of 525 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 4 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ering, 2 papers in Biomedical Engineering and 0 papers in Infectious Diseases. Recurrent topics in Kimberly Dickey's work include Organic Electronics and Photovoltaics (4 papers), Thin-Film Transistor Technologies (4 papers) and Nanowire Synthesis and Applications (2 papers). Kimberly Dickey is often cited by papers focused on Organic Electronics and Photovoltaics (4 papers), Thin-Film Transistor Technologies (4 papers) and Nanowire Synthesis and Applications (2 papers). Kimberly Dickey collaborates with scholars based in United States. Kimberly Dickey's co-authors include Yueh‐Lin Loo, John E. Anthony, Keith J. Stevenson, Timothy J. Smith, Sankar Subramanian, Joung Eun Yoo, Shaochen Chen, Li‐Hsin Han and Yueh‐Lin Loo and has published in prestigious journals such as Advanced Materials, Applied Physics Letters and Chemistry of Materials.

All Works

4 of 4 papers shown
1.
Dickey, Kimberly, Timothy J. Smith, Keith J. Stevenson, et al.. (2007). Establishing Efficient Electrical Contact to the Weak Crystals of Triethylsilylethynyl Anthradithiophene. Chemistry of Materials. 19(22). 5210–5215. 31 indexed citations
2.
Dickey, Kimberly, Sankar Subramanian, John E. Anthony, et al.. (2007). Large-area patterning of a solution-processable organic semiconductor to reduce parasitic leakage and off currents in thin-film transistors. Applied Physics Letters. 90(24). 244103–244103. 52 indexed citations
3.
Dickey, Kimberly, John E. Anthony, & Yueh‐Lin Loo. (2006). Improving Organic Thin‐Film Transistor Performance through Solvent‐Vapor Annealing of Solution‐Processable Triethylsilylethynyl Anthradithiophene. Advanced Materials. 18(13). 1721–1726. 365 indexed citations breakdown →
4.
Smith, Timothy J., et al.. (2006). High‐Resolution Characterization of Pentacene/Polyaniline Interfaces in Thin‐Film Transistors. Advanced Functional Materials. 16(18). 2409–2414. 77 indexed citations
